CECO Environmental Corp is an industrial company, serving industrial air, industrial water, and energy transition markets. It offers various engineered and configured products and solutions, including dampers and diverters, selective catalytic reduction systems, severe-service and industrial cyclones, dust collectors, thermal oxidizers, filtration systems, wet and dry scrubbers, water treatment packages, industrial silencers, etc. These products are offered through brands like Western Airducts, WK, Wakefield Acoustics, Transcend, Verantis, and others. The company's reportable segments are: Engineered Systems, which derive maximum revenue, and Industrial Process Solutions. Geographically, it derives key revenue from the U.S., followed by the Netherlands, the UK, China, and other markets.
Neuberger Berman Next Generation Connectivity Fund Inc. is a non-diversified, closed-end management investment company. The fund's investment objectives are to provide capital appreciation and income. Under normal market conditions, the Fund will invest at least 80% of its total assets in equity securities issued by U.S. and non-U.S. companies, in any market capitalization range, that is relevant to the theme of investing in NextGen Companies.
